We compared two Mobile platform GPUs: 1024MB VRAM GeForce 610 and 2GB VRAM NVS 5400M to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A GeForce 610 's Advantages
Lower TDP (12W vs 35W)
NVIDIA NVS 5400M 's Advantages
Released 6 months late
More VRAM (2GB vs 1GB)
Larger VRAM bandwidth (28.80GB/s vs 14.40GB/s)
48 additional rendering cores
